Mental Health Treatment Process
Occasionally an individual's symptoms become so serious that they require inpatient therapy at a medical facility or long-term program. This generally takes place when they are in danger of harming themselves or others.


Upon admission, a therapy strategy is developed. It includes objectives and goals that are specific, reasonable and tailored for the customer.

Cognitive Behavior Modification (CBT).
Cognitive behavior modification (CBT) is a goal-oriented kind of psychiatric therapy, which mental health professionals use to treat mental health conditions and emotional issues. It is based on the principle that all people's thoughts, sensations and behaviors relate.

For this reason, CBT is a solution-focused treatment that aids customers find out to recognize purposeless reasoning patterns and replace them with even more practical ones. It likewise educates customers to practice and develop their skills through homework jobs beyond treatment sessions.

CBT is just one of one of the most commonly investigated and efficient forms of psychotherapy, and has been shown to be reliable in treating a variety of problems, such as anxiety, anxiety conditions, substance abuse and eating conditions. Change specialists utilize CBT to educate customers just how to acknowledge and test distorted reasoning patterns, modification maladaptive behavior and create more flexible coping methods. In this way, customers become their very own therapists and gain control over their mental wellness. As an example, in the case of stress and anxiety disorders, therapists help customers manage their signs and symptoms with direct exposure therapy and discover calming abilities to enhance quality of life.

Psychodynamic Therapy.
Psychodynamic Treatment entails probing unconscious conflicts in the past that can affect existing ideas and behaviors. For instance, a client might be available in with phobias or somatic (physical) issues that can be linked to repressed anxieties. In such instances, the therapist will certainly assist the client discover their childhood years experiences to identify adverse effects and create better coping mechanisms.

A major element of this psychiatric therapy is free association, where individuals can freely discuss their thoughts without worry of judgment. This makes it possible for the therapist to recognize any type of quelched emotions that may be influencing the client. In addition, the specialist may try to find any patterns in the individual's relationships to uncover underlying subconscious conflict.

Psychodynamic psychotherapy is rooted in theories developed by Sigmund Freud and his contemporaries such as Melanie Klein and Anna Freud. It likewise integrates various other psychological techniques like object relationships and vanity psychology. It is typically utilized to deal with stress and anxiety, state of mind problems such as clinical depression and bipolar disorder, and connection troubles.

Interpersonal Treatment.
Social therapy (IPT) assists you recognize how your partnerships with others impact your state of mind. It's a time-limited therapy that works well as a stand-alone treatment or in mix with medication for anxiety and various other mental health and wellness problems.

Throughout the opening phase of IPT, which normally lasts one to 3 sessions, your therapist mental health clinics will interview you and execute an analysis to assist recognize what's going on. As an example, they could ask you to produce a social stock to evaluate your partnership patterns and evaluate the high quality of your existing relationships.

The therapist will certainly after that focus on the difficult area in your life that is activating depressive signs and symptoms. They will make use of analytical strategies, communication training or other strategies to find methods to resolve the concern and improve your partnerships. This center phase commonly lasts via sessions four to 14. The last session (sessions 14-16) focuses on refining the feeling of loss that comes when therapy ends and helping you cultivate new strategies for dealing with this obstacle location must it turn up once again.

Group Therapy.
Group therapy offers a risk-free setting to express feelings and experiences in an anonymous setup. It can additionally aid customers procedure family members or relational concerns that might be causing them anxiety. Additionally, the group can aid customers establish social skills and gain from each other. In general, the specialist acts as a mediator and version of group standards.

While some patients may originally be hesitant to share their battle with complete strangers, they frequently locate the experience fulfilling. By observing others that fight with similar concerns make progress, they can be motivated to advance their own recovery course. Furthermore, group participants can function as role models and assistance for every other. The ideal group specialists have the ability to create a setting that motivates count on and open interaction among participants. They can utilize icebreakers and collaborative workouts to foster team cohesion. They can also establish clear expectations regarding privacy and make sure that participants appreciate each other's privacy.
